A Study of the Knowledge and Attitude about the Workers' Health Care of the Workers and Health Managers in an Industrial Complex in Kyungnam


Abstract
This study was conducted for the purpose of providing the fundamental data for a countermeasure of health care magnagement-working environment measurement, regural health check, etc.
The author surveyed the knowledge and attitude about the worker's health care of 373 workers and 45 health manager in an industrial complex in Kyungnam from December 1991 to February 1992.
@ES The results were summerized as follows.
@EN 1. 75.9% of workers has gotten regural health check continuously.
2. 13.7% of workers didn't know abut a kind of regural health check that was gotton. And just 18.8% of workers knew exactly that he got special health check.
3. After health checking, 70.5% of workers received the result of health check. Although they received the result, 26.0% of them didn't know about the contents of the result.
4. 65.4% of workers and 95.5% of health manager answered that regural health check was useful for workers' health care.
5. 58.2% of workers answered that he didn't know the method of health care of own industry.
6. In 31 factories (68.9%), health education performanced and 17.8% of workers never attended there even through health education performanced.
7. 52.3% of workers and 80.0% of health managers answered that working environment measurement is useful for workers' health care.
8. 42.6% of workers and 28.9% of health managers answered that the development of occupational disease is possible at working place.
9. 63.2% of workers and 44.2% of health managers answered that the personal protects are helpful to the prevention of occupational disease.
As the results of this study, it is necessary that the workers and health managers know and understand the activities of occupational health exactly, for achieving the effective results of the activities.
And, we should develop the effective programme for educating and training the workers and the health managers.
